"As the last U.S. troops withdrew from Iraq on Sunday, friends and family of the first and last
American fighters killed in combat were cherishing their memories rather than dwelling on
whether the war and their sacrifice was worth it.
Nearly 4,500 American fighters died before the last U.S. troops crossed the border into Kuwait.
David Hickman, 23, of Greensboro was the last of those war casualties, killed in November by
the kind of improvised bomb that was a signature weapon of this war.
"David Emanuel Hickman. Doesn't that name just bring out a smile to your face?" said Logan
Trainum, one of Hickman's closest friends, at the funeral where the soldier was laid to rest
after a ceremony in a Greensboro church packed with friends and family.
Trainum says he's not spending time asking why Hickman died: "There aren't enough facts
available for me to have a defined opinion about things. I'm just sad, and pray that my best
friend didn't lay down his life for nothing."
